I've been having trouble getting my TPS fixed. There were three codes that popped up saying:
P0171 System was too lean (Bank 1)
P0172 System was too rich (Bank 1) and
P0120 Throttle; Pedal Position Sensor; Switch A Circuit
The mechanic I brought it to did some basic maintenance and it took the check engine light off for a day or too, but my truck still starts to idle and die if I don't give it any gas. Please Help.
